State COLORADO WINTER PARK (regional info) > Tourism & Travel Guide: Winter Park BEST WESTERN ALPENGLO LODGE THE VINTAGE RESORT The former railroad center of WINTER PARK , 67 miles northwest of Denver, may not be Colorado's trendiest resort, but its wide, ever-expanding variety of ski and bike terrain, friendly atmosphere and good-value lodgings draw over one million visitors a year. As the only publicly owned resort in the state, it has great facilities for kids and disabled skiers - and the 200-acre Discovery Park , an excellent, economical area for beginners. Experienced skiers, in turn, relish the mogul runs on the awesome Mary Jane Mountain , the fluffy snows of the Parsenn Bowl, and the backcountry idyll of Vasquez Cirque . In addition to skiing, you can snowmobile the Continental Divide on a one-hour tour with Trailblazers in Fraser (tel 970/726-8452), or around a 25-mile course at Mountain Madness (tel 970/726-4529), just north of town. Summer visitors can enjoy six hundred miles of mountain bike trails, some of the best of which are accessible from the chair-lift, in addition to the super-fun mile-and-a-half-long Alpine Slide and several contemporary music festivals.
